The Importance of AI Drawdown

Amongst all financial investment performance metrics, AI drawdown has turned into one of the most crucial indicators for examining economic knowledge.

Drawdown determines the decrease from a portfolio's greatest worth to its subsequent lowest point before recuperating.

Although many individuals focus exclusively on investment returns, experienced portfolio supervisors recognize that threat management is similarly vital.

An AI model that generates outstanding gains while subjecting capitalists to enormous losses may not represent an reliable investment approach.

Think about 2 hypothetical AI systems.

The very first creates a return of 40 percent but experiences numerous periods where the profile loses more than half its value prior to recuperating.

The second produces a return of 30 percent while limiting temporary losses to just ten percent.

Lots of specialist capitalists would certainly favor the 2nd model because it shows better uniformity, stronger self-control, and extra reliable threat management.

AI drawdown as a result gives beneficial insight into how responsibly an AI manages unpredictability.

Lower drawdowns normally indicate that a model understands diversity, position sizing, market threat, and capital preservation.

High drawdowns might recommend too much focus, emotional decision-making, or not enough assessment of disadvantage risks.

Consequently, AI drawdown has actually turned into one of the defining metrics in modern-day AI money benchmarks.
